I went with v4.56 of the VIA Hyperion driver set. Seems only the AGP and INF aspects of the driver set are applicable to WinXP systems any more (only whatever is relevent gets installed in any case). The Hyperion Pro driver set incorporate SATA/RAID functionality (which I don't have) and I doubt I'd be able to garner any sort of advantage from whatever putative improvements the later Hyperion Pro driverset may ostensibly entail regarding AGP performance.

All I know is the CPU-AGP controller now sports a date in 2003, rather than 2001. Should be good enough for my ancient system.
